The Technical Skills You'll Learn in Plumbing Training
Plumbing modern technology 101, the very first training course, describes the standard of the plumbing trade. The objective of this first training course is to teach trainees the basics of the trade or to acquaint property owners with some diy techniques.
Much of the issues attended to in this initial of the plumbing programs are those that will certainly come up almost on a daily basis in a plumbings function life. These consist of the system that supplies a property or business building with water, soldering, vents as well as drains pipes, installation of plumbing associated components and repair work of the very same.
The specifics of the course include a check out standard plumbing safety ideas and also familiarization with the jargon as well as standard regards to the plumbing trade. Soldering is a vital part of this plumbing program also.
Hereafter lesson each student ought to have the ability to pick the ideal soldering materials, clean the metals to obtain them all set for soldering, prepare the joint and also solder a tubing connection the proper and safe method.
Water service becomes part of this standard training course materials and training. Students discover the design of a residence or business cellar, the ins and outs of picking the right materials and the proper place of the necessary devices.
Trainees find out to mount a drainpipe, along with an air flow and also waste system. They additionally learn about installing fixtures in these online plumbing courses.

Things You Should Know About Plumbing


Plumbing is often one of the most overlooked systems both in high-rise buildings and residential apartment blocks. Fixing a leaky faucet or a running toilet in your own house is one thing, but if you own a company that operates in the property management sector, plumbing issues can have grave effects both from a financial and business standpoint.



Whether you manage schools, office building, apartment blocks or healthcare facilities, you will not be spared by the occasional plumbing issue occurring and filling your inbox with complaints. And for good reason – faulty plumbing systems can affect the property in many ways, from permeating the building with unpleasant smells, helping mold develop in certain places by creating moisture, to degrading the overall structural integrity of the building.


Automatic Leaks Detector


Taps, sinks, pipes, and other items may not last forever and may eventually weaken and start leaking. Some property managers let pipes stay for long after they have proven in disrepair, so eventually installing new ones at some point is essential. Assess the damages that the pipes and sinks have suffered and, if the situation calls of it, replace them with brand new ones. From a business standpoint, it is cheaper to replace old pipes than completely renovating the interior in the aftermath of a water-related accident. You can ask a professional plumber to inspect your water system and upgrade where necessary. Consider installing the latest systems which can detect leaks in property.



Moreover, keep in mind that the piping infrastructure in the United States is aging rapidly. In 2017, the average age of most pipes in the country was around 47 years old. The situation is worse in in New York and Philadelphia, where the pipes are pushing 70. Therefore, ensuring that the building has a working plumbing is vital.


Water Pressure


Water pressure is another plumbing aspect that experts should notice. Typically, in your average household, the water pressure should be under 80 psi.



The situation changes when it comes to bigger structures, such as high-rises or other public buildings. Buildings which are higher than eight stories require pumps, which transport the H2O into water tanks on the highest floor. This system is designed to ensure that water is distributed equally amongst all floors without sacrificing the level of water pressure.



On the other hand, high water pressure is one of the main causes of water-related accidents in all types of buildings, especially in smart homes. Moreover, since plumbing and construction technology has advanced, damages caused by flooding are even more expensive to repair.


Submeter


When it comes to large buildings like high-rises, submetering is the most practical approach. A submeter is an intricate system that allows landlords, condominium associations, landlords or other legal entities that manage buildings to charge tenants for individual consumption.



A study ordered by GE Sales Development Retail and Property Management and conducted by Lou Mane shows that submetering is the most practical approach regarding consumption measurement.


Prevention


As always, taking preventive measures is cheaper than handling the problems right after they occur. One way to prevent any plumbing accidents is to ensure that everything is correctly installed. Loose pipes or improper installation of plumbing traps for urinals are two of the most common causes of damage to the building. That is why regular retightening and check-ups are important to perform.



The same thing applies to toilets. If you are receiving complaints about broken toilets, it is cheaper on the long run to just replace them than doing shoddy patch-up works.
